Barq pacts with Mastercard to equip consumers in Saudi Arabia

Riyadh - Sharikat Mubasher: Barq, a leading digital wallet for consumers and businesses in Saudi Arabia, partnered with Mastercard to empower its customers in the Kingdom with advanced payment acceptance solutions through Mastercard Gateway, the fintech company announced in a statement.

Through this partnership, Barq will leverage Mastercard Gateway technology to equip its merchants and consumers around the Kingdom with greater access to a wide range of value-added services and personalized solutions that cater to their unique needs and preferences.

This partnership will expand Barq’s service offering, utilizing Mastercard Gateway’s seamless payment processing and robust fraud prevention technology.

Ahmed Alenazi, Founder and CEO of Barq, said: “We have partnered with Mastercard to deliver the modern offerings that consumers demand. Mastercard has developed a world-class range of cross-border services and remittance solutions. We look forward to working closely with the technology company to empower the people and communities we serve with seamless access to these tools.”

Meanwhile, Maria Parpou, Executive Vice President of Mastercard Payment Gateway affirmed the company’s dedication to serving as a partner of choice to the Kingdom in its transformation journey.

“We strive to play a key role in driving the growth and development of the Saudi fintech ecosystem, working closely with innovative companies such as Barq. Together, we aim to redefine financial services, curating an expansive portfolio of world-class offerings that empower people and businesses to make payments as they please,” Parpou elaborated.

Mastercard Gateway offers advanced payment processing and fraud prevention technology to acquiring banks, merchants, micro-merchants, and technology partners.
